Kristen’s Wildest Move Yet and Xander Pays the Price
Kristen opened Monday with the same ask she always has. Kill EJ. She added serious money to the offer this time and Xander’s answer came back immediately. “Go to hell.” Kristen mocked him for going soft and suggested he did not even need to get his hands dirty. Just call in his goon squad. Still no. Xander told her he had been in therapy and that he had genuinely evolved. Kristen found that far more amusing than convincing.

What came next was genuinely unhinged. Kristen went in for a kiss, and things escalated into full chaos from there. She tied Xander up, and the encounter went places nobody had on their 2026 bingo card. Afterwards, Kristen looked completely satisfied with herself, while Xander had to physically free himself from the situation. He wrenched his elbow badly in the process. Kristen did not spare a single thought for that before walking away.
Days Of Our Lives Recap: Sarah Treats Xander and Brady Steps Up
Xander eventually showed up in Sarah’s exam room at the hospital, cradling his injured elbow. He had not expected her to be working, but there was nothing to do but go forward. Sarah noticed the belt marks on his wrist immediately and mostly just rolled her eyes. She confirmed the elbow was not fractured but very much dislocated. Then she grabbed it and popped it back into place without warning. Xander yelped, “Ouch! You enjoyed that didn’t you?” Sarah confirmed that yes, she absolutely did. He left wearing a sling.

Right around the same time, Brady went out of his way for Sarah in a gesture that showed just how much he genuinely cared about her well-being. Victoria also stopped by to visit Sarah, adding a warmer and softer layer to what had otherwise been a very charged day for her.
Chanel Hides the Truth While Paulina Worries About Abe
Over at Paulina’s place, Chanel felt a pain pang at exactly the wrong moment as Paulina walked in. She covered it fast, claiming she had just hit her funny bone. Paulina accepted it and steered the conversation toward Lexie, admitting that family was the only thing keeping her sane. Theo and Abe had barely left Lexie’s bedside, and Paulina was quietly wrestling with what Lexie’s return meant for her marriage to Abe.

Lani, meanwhile, ran into Joy and Kelsey at the park and instantly recognized Joy as a former soap star. Joy gave her the complete rundown on the Alex and Kelsey situation without holding anything back. Lani headed home, and while Paulina stepped away to make tea, she turned to Chanel directly. She told her firmly that their mother would want to know what was happening with her health, regardless of the Lexie situation. Chanel had nowhere left to deflect.
Days Of Our Lives Recap: Stephanie Walks Out and Alex Keeps Missing Every Signal
When Stephanie got home and spotted a stuffed elephant sitting there for Kelsey, she had reached her absolute limit. She told Alex clearly that she was not ready to be a stepmother. Alex, genuinely confused, pointed out that she already was Kelsey’s stepmom. He then wondered aloud whether he was supposed to choose between them. Stephanie told him flatly that this was not what she signed up for. Her shooting lesson reminder came through, and she walked straight out.

Alex stood alone until Joy texted about legal matters, and he practically jumped at the chance to meet her. He brought Horton the elephant to the small park near the square where Joy and Kelsey were waiting. He told Joy he wanted Stephanie to meet Kelsey properly before things moved further. Joy informed him casually that Stephanie had already met Kelsey and had not exactly seemed thrilled. Alex had no idea. Later, Stephanie was at the shooting range, telling Brady everything. She said she hoped that loving Alex enough might eventually mean loving Kelsey too.
Gwen Breaks Down and Walks Into the Most Awkward Moment in Salem
Gwen sat down with Leo over coffee and tried to hold herself together. She did not manage it for long. She broke down sobbing, and Leo dropped the Spectator journalist act completely. He made it clear he was not chasing a scoop. He was there as her friend. Gwen opened up about Xander and touched on EJ carefully, keeping things vague and non-incriminating. Leo listened, and that was exactly what she needed.

They headed back to the Salem Inn and walked straight into Kristen, hair wild and looking thoroughly pleased with herself. Leo looked her over and said she looked like she had “just auditioned for an ’80s hairband.” He made a comment about her getting her buttons pushed, and Gwen, completely unaware of what had just happened between Kristen and Xander, congratulated Kristen warmly. She had no idea that she and Kristen had just shared the same man. The irony sat heavily in the air, and nobody said a word.
